Writing a parser with operator precedence:

This depends on how the BNF rules are written:

((3*2) + 2 / 4 )

The operation happens with /,* and then it adds the two results.

((3*2) + 2), 4 are two factors.

3*2 is a term which is a combination of two factors. And the final expression is a (+,-) combination of terms.

In BNF:

<expression> := [-] <term> | [+|- <term>].. 
<term> := <factor> | [*|/ <factor>]..
<factor> := <number> | "(" <expression> ")"

[].. is repeated zero to many times. so that constitutes a while loop.
